## Core Components of Sanitary Pads

### 1. Top Sheet (Cover Stock)

The top sheet is the layer that comes in direct contact with the skin. It’s typically made from:

– Non-woven fabric (polypropylene or polyethylene)
– Perforated plastic film
– Cotton or bamboo fiber blends

Key properties:
– Soft and comfortable
– Quick-drying
– Hypoallergenic
– Breathable

### 2. Absorbent Core

This is the most important functional layer that absorbs menstrual flow. Common materials include:

– Fluff pulp (wood cellulose)
– Superabsorbent polymers (SAP)
– Airlaid paper
– Cotton or rayon fibers

Absorption properties:
– High liquid retention capacity
– Rapid absorption rate
– Good distribution of fluid
– Minimal rewet (keeps surface dry)

### 3. Back Sheet

The bottom layer prevents leakage and provides structural support. Materials include:

– Polyethylene film
– Breathable microporous film
– Biodegradable materials (PLA, PBAT)

Important characteristics:
– Waterproof
– Flexible
– Durable
– Some offer breathability

### 4. Adhesive Components

These include:
– Pressure-sensitive adhesive for pad attachment
– Hot melt adhesive for layer bonding
– Release paper for packaging

## Specialized Materials in Premium Pads

### 1. Organic Cotton

– Natural and chemical-free
– Soft and breathable
– Hypoallergenic properties
– Biodegradable

### 2. Bamboo Fiber

– Naturally antibacterial
– Highly absorbent
– Eco-friendly
– Soft texture

### 3. Charcoal-Infused Layers

– Odor control
– Antibacterial properties
– Additional absorption

### 4. Aloe Vera or Vitamin E Coatings

– Soothing effect
– Skin protection
– Reduces irritation

## Material Safety Considerations

Manufacturers must ensure all materials:

– Are free from harmful chemicals (dioxins, chlorine, pesticides)
– Meet international safety standards
– Are dermatologically tested
– Don’t contain known allergens

## Environmental Impact of Materials

The industry is moving toward more sustainable options:

– Biodegradable materials
– Plant-based plastics
– Chlorine-free bleaching processes
– Reduced SAP content
– Compostable packaging

## Future Material Innovations

Emerging trends include:

– Smart materials that change color for health monitoring
– Nanofiber technology for better absorption
– Fully compostable plant-based materials
– Antibacterial coatings from natural sources
